问答详情
源自:6-6 数组的应用(二)

左边的例题里if语句外写return-1的话不会冲掉前面的return i么

为什么不是if(arr[i]==value){return i;}else{return-1;}呢


提问者:sdsdsdsdf 2016-03-27 20:47

个回答

  • Eason_Mar
    2016-04-07 17:37:30

    C/C++ 中,reutrn语句是这样定义的:通过在函数中使用返回语句,返回一个值给函数,同时终止函数的调用,返回主函数。(注意:同时终止函数的调用,也就是说函数在运行到return时就会终止了。)


  • qq_Jellybeans_0
    2016-03-29 13:50:06

    我不会